Output 84d32d6eb20752b1fe63067084883c4b9a2e784f6755aea12a59d9a23e4d3fea:78

value
105829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b60399853398c3774308d51cac11499a0303f20a OP_EQUAL
address
3JHRDZspmLTXun2eCtdmsshvfEczTLoSTe
transaction
84d32d6eb20752b1fe63067084883c4b9a2e784f6755aea12a59d9a23e4d3fea
confirmations
271171
spent
true